Minimum front street perimeter yard setback is 20’-0” (Unified Development Code – UDC 6.4.5.C.1). Side and rear yard setbacks are 6’-0” or 2/3 the height of exterior building wall, whichever is greater (UDC Table 6.3-2.A).

02. COMMENT: Per UDC 6.6.3.C, detached accessory buildings are not permitted in the buildable area (the area between the principal building and the front street lot line). The two storage sheds shown on the site plan are in the buildable area. If the applicant wants to keep the sheds in this location, a Board of Adjustment Variance would be necessary. 03. COMMENT: Per UDC Table 6.3-2.A, the minimum side yard setbacks are 6’-0” or 2/3 the height of the exterior wall, whichever is greater. Based on aerial photos, it appears the carport was built up to the property line (please add this dimension on next submittal).

If the carport is less than 1’-0” from the property line, a Board of Adjustment Variance would be necessary (see Comment 2 for more information).

If the carport is more than 1’-0” from the property line, a Design Development Option (DDO) will be required.
